The Sun Hydraulics DRBAKEV (DRBAKEV) is a normally open, direct-acting, 2-way directional cartridge valve designed for use in moderate flow circuits. It is utilized either independently or to actuate larger pilot-operated directional cartridges or logic cartridges. The valve operates by shifting when the pressure differential between port 1 and port 3 surpasses its set value. Notably, pressure at port 3 directly adds to the valve setting, which may restrict its use as a work port in certain circuits; a 4-port version can be considered if this presents an issue. The direct-acting design ensures low internal leakage and minimal pilot flow consumption. This model is interchangeable with pilot-operated versions, fitting the same cavities and maintaining identical flow paths. The DRBAKEV is not bistable and can modulate between two positions as needed. It features Sun's floating style construction, minimizing risks of internal parts binding due to excessive installation torque or cavity-cartridge machining variations. The valve fits into a T-11A cavity and belongs to Series 1 with a capacity of 7 gpm (28 L/min). Factory pressure settings are established at 4 gpm (15 L/min), with a maximum operating pressure of 5000 psi (350 bar). Maximum valve leakage at 110 SUS (24 cSt) is limited to 2 in\u00b3/min (30 cc/min). For adjustments, the number of clockwise turns required to increase the setting is approximately five and a half turns. Key dimensions include a valve hex size of 7/8 inch (22.2 mm) and an installation torque ranging from 30 to 35 lbf ft (41 to 47 Nm). The adjustment screw internal hex size measures at 5/32 inch (4 mm), while the locknut hex size is set at 9/16 inch (15 mm), requiring a torque of between 80 to 90 lbf in (9 to 10 Nm). The model weighs approximately .60 lb (.30 kg) and uses Viton seal kits under part number: 990011006.
